Climate overview of Lesterps
The climate in Lesterps, Poitou-Charentes, France, is marked by large temperature swings across the seasons, ranging from 27°C (81°F) in August to 9°C (48°F) in January.
Lesterps sees a moderate amount of rain/snowfall, totalling around 964 mm (38 in) per year. It experiences warm summers and cold winters, creating some seasonal variation. July is the sunniest month, averaging 7.9 hours of sunshine per day.

Monthly Temperature in Lesterps
In Lesterps, temperatures differ significantly between summer and winter months. Average maximum daytime temperatures range from a comfortable 27°C (81°F) in August, the warmest time of the year, to a chilly 9°C (48°F) during cooler months like January.
At night, you can expect temperatures ranging from 15°C (59°F) in August to around 2°C (36°F) during January.

Rainfall in Lesterps
On average, Lesterps receives a reasonable amount of rain/snowfall, with an annual precipitation of 964 mm (38 in). Year-round, Lesterps has a balanced climate with minimal variation in precipitation. The difference between the wettest month, December, with 95 mm (3.7 in), and the driest month, July, with 58 mm (2.3 in), is minimal. For more details, please visit our Lesterps Precipitation page.

Sunshine Hours in Lesterps
Seasonal changes in sunshine hours are quite dramatic in Lesterps. While July receives considerable daily sunshine with up to 7.9 hours, December marks the darkest time of the year, where sunshine is scarce with only 2.6 hours of sunlight per day.

Humidity in Lesterps by Month
The relative humidity is high throughout the year in Lesterps.
The city experiences its highest humidity in January, reaching 85%. In April, the humidity drops to its lowest level at 71%. What does this mean? Read our detailed page on humidity levels for further details.

Best Time to Visit Lesterps
Monthly ratings reflect general weather comfort, based on daytime temperature and rainfall. Swimming and winter conditions are highlighted separately where relevant.
- Best overall: May, June, July, August and September
- Warmest weather: July and August
- Most sunshine: June, July and August
- Fewest rainy days: June, July, August and September
- Seasonal pattern: Warm summers and cold winters
Frequently asked questions about the climate in Lesterps
What is the best time to visit Lesterps?
May, June, July, August and September typically offer the most optimal weather in Lesterps. In contrast, January and December tend to have less optimal conditions. Lesterps has warm summers and cold winters.
What temperatures can I expect in Lesterps?
Daytime highs range from 9°C (48°F) in January to 27°C (81°F) in August. Nighttime lows range from 2°C (36°F) to 15°C (59°F). Temperatures vary considerably through the year.
How much rain does Lesterps get?
Annual rainfall is around 964 mm (38 in). December is the wettest month with 95 mm (3.7 in), while July is the driest with 58 mm (2.3 in).
How sunny is Lesterps?
Lesterps receives around 1,906 hours of sunshine per year. July is the sunniest month with 237 hours, while December is the cloudiest with just 77 hours.
